Definition

What is it: Post-renovation airing out is a safety process involving continuous ventilation to disperse volatile organic compounds (VOCs) released from new materials. This procedure is critical in urban environments like Singapore where occupants spend 90% of their time indoors.

What is it used for: It is used to prevent health issues such as headaches, dizziness, and respiratory irritation caused by chemicals like formaldehyde and benzene. It ensures that indoor air quality reaches safe levels before families move into a freshly upgraded property.

Attributes

Key Facts
Air-conditioning should not be used during the airing process as it recirculates indoor air without replacing it with fresh outdoor air. [1]

Key Facts
Singapore's tropical climate, with humidity levels between 70% and 90%, slows down the evaporation and dispersal of VOCs. [1]
Key Facts
Standard HDB renovations including painting and minimal carpentry require an absolute minimum airing period of 2 weeks. [1]
Key Facts
Extensive renovations involving built-in cabinetry and vinyl flooring require 4 to 8 weeks of continuous ventilation. [1]
Capability
HEPA air purifiers equipped with activated carbon filters can be used to actively absorb VOCs during the ventilation period. [1]
Requirement
For families with newborns, pregnant mothers, or individuals with asthma, the recommended airing duration is 8 to 12 weeks. [1]
